Discover the exquisite Château de Laubade Bas-Armagnac 1927, bottled in 1987. This vintage spirit exemplifies the rich heritage of Armagnac production, offering a deep, complex flavour profile that is both luxurious and refined. Ideal for collectors and connoisseurs, this bottle celebrates over nine decades of craftsmanship and tradition.

- Age: 95 years
- Vintage: 1927
- Bottled: 1987
- Region: Bas-Armagnac
